Once again we’ve delved into the programme collection of MILES McCLAGAN (@TheSkyStrikers) and came across some wonderful oddities over at BRISTOL CITY. We insist you to visit his site to enjoy more HERE


If there’s one thing they loved down at Ashton Gate it was messing about with animals; from the PG Tips monkeys to performing seals, the Robins couldn’t get enough of horsing around.

Brc1

brfc11

brc3


They also liked to partake in a little bit of dress up when not out on the pitch.

brc8

brc5


In fact, football seemed to just get in the way of the busy social life of the Bristol City side of the 1970s. Here they are on a tour of the local sausage making factory.

brc10


When not raiding the dress-up box or stuffing the suspicious pork meat into local bangers, the players had ample other distractions to keep them busy – from the Sex Pistols to sexy birds (TM the 1970s) with the rock n’ roll attraction of a bowling green under the new stand, Bristol City was the place to be.
